Ms. Anita Karki Creates History As Nepal First Female APF Officer To Summit Mount Everest

On 17 May 2026 at 10:20 AM, our climbers proudly stood on the summit of Mount Everest (8,848.86 m), the highest point on Earth, proving once again that courage, discipline, and determination can conquer even the greatest heights.

 

In challenging weather conditions, our team pushed beyond limits with unwavering spirit, strong teamwork, and the true heart of mountaineering to reach the Roof of the World.

Very special congratulations to Ms. Anita Karki 🇳🇵 Assistant Head Constable of the Armed Police Force (APF), South Asian Games medalist, and talented épée fencer representing Nepal’s APF Club on this historic and inspiring achievement.
